Also known as floss flower, Ageratum provides a purple blue pop of color and fun texture to bouquets. Ht. 18-24". This is a warm season tender annual, it should be planted after the threat of frost is over in your area. A Snuck Share is a monthly CSA Farm share program that offers fresh locally grown greens with the option to add on our farm fresh eggs, seasonal fruit, yogurt, and fresh bread on a year-round basis as a weekly pick-up at our farm in Pleasant Grove, and other convenient locations throughout Utah County. Palest pink, almost white wheat type celosia. Pink deepens as temperatures cool down. Great for market bouquets and Bridal work. Ht. 36-48" This is a warm season tender annual, it should be planted after the threat of frost is over in your area. The Fugal family has owned the 3-acre farm in Pleasant Grove, Utah since the 1800s.
